12. ER-A7RS
Fig. 10
1) Remove the rear cover.
2) Remove the rear display.
3) Remove the two screws 
2
 from the chassis.
4) Insert the I/F PWB 
1
 to the connector.
5) Fasten the bracket to the chassis using screws 
2
.
6) Connect the RS232 cables to the I/F PWB.
Fig. 11
7) Install the rear display.
